Summer has arrived early! While the outdoor pool at Tiemeyer Park was closed last summer, we are able to open the big pool and slides this summer. Money form the American Recovery Act will be used to help subsidize this effort, as the City’s finances recover from COVID. Despite press statements to the contrary, these funds have pretty strict limitations for their use. We have started a comprehensive study of the entire pool complex, partially funded through a Municipal Park Planning Grant. The study is being conducted by Counsilman-Hunsaker, a nationally recognized aquatics consultant. The existing facility is over 30 years old, was funded by sales tax revenue from the old Northwest Plaza and has reached the end of its projected lifespan. The study will look at the existing condition, operating and maintenance costs. Next it will look at programming a market analysis. Finally it will provide options for a renovation or reconstruction as well as potential costs for all.
This summer marks the first full season of street construction work funded by the City-wide Transportation Development District (TDD). The TDD will fund $1 million annually in street improvements. Special signs will identify projects funded by the TDD. Click here for a list of streets that will be addressed this summer. We are also planning improvements to the City’s Public Works Facility to facilitate the transition of the staff to full time street maintenance activities. We have also started addressing street trees and started planning for sidewalk repair next year. You will also see the department beginning to replace street signs.
We have also, thanks to the American Recovery Act, been able to reopen the Community Center. The effects of COVID still linger and it will take some time for everything to get back to normal. I look forward to continuing the progress we have made.
